What Delah Coffee is known for

Delah Coffee serves Yemeni-inflected drinks — Adeni Chai, a Yemeni Latte, and Sana'ani and Jubani blends — across six Bay Area and Midwest cafés including Dublin, CA. Coffee is sustainably sourced, hand-picked, and micro-roasted.

Delah Coffee runs six cafés spanning the Bay Area and the Midwest — two San Francisco locations, plus Oakland, Berkeley, Dublin and San Diego in California, and a Naperville, Illinois outpost — built around a menu that leans into Arabian coffee tradition rather than a generic third-wave list. Alongside standard espresso drinks, the menu includes an Adeni Chai, a Yemeni Latte, and specialty blends named Sana'ani and Jubani, all referencing regions and cities associated with Yemen's centuries-old coffee-growing history.

The company states its coffee is sustainably sourced, hand-picked and micro-roasted, treating the drink, in its own words, as 'a social experience that brings people together' rather than a purely transactional order. Beyond the café menu, Delah runs a rewards program, sells gift cards, and offers franchise opportunities — a growth structure that has carried the brand from its Bay Area base into the Midwest.

The Dublin location, at 6694 Amador Plaza Road, is one of two East Bay-area cafés (alongside Oakland) in a chain whose broader footprint stretches from downtown San Francisco to suburban Chicago, unified by the same Yemeni-inflected menu rather than a single flagship identity.
